Geo Owl is seeking motivated Apprentice Active Geolocation Operators to support a critical mission in Augusta, GA.
Location: Augusta, GA
Clearance Required: TS/SCI clearance with Polygraph
Position Summary
The Apprentice Active Geolocation Operator will provide 24/7 operational support by leveraging specialized skills and procedures to produce intelligence products in accordance with customer policies and requirements. This role requires the ability to work rotating shifts in a high-tempo operational environment.
Responsibilities
Conduct active geolocation missions under supervision using approved government systems and tools.
Acquire, analyze, and develop relevant intelligence products from RF collection and/or Direction-Finding operations.
Support mission planning and target development through real-time geolocation data.
Maintain accurate mission logs and contribute to after-action reviews.
Successfully complete initial active certification training within 30 days of assignment.
Collaborate with senior operators to apply TDOA/FDOA and other advanced geolocation techniques.
Required Qualifications
Two (2) years of relevant operational experience within the last five (5) years.
Experience conducting RF collection and/or Direction-Finding operations.
Familiarity with customer tools and databases for intelligence production.
Must possess an active TS/SCI clearance with Polygraph.
Desired Qualifications
Ability to obtain certification in active geolocation techniques for multiple technologies.
Prior geolocation, collection operator, or other specialized certifications.
Basic understanding of RF theory, wireless communications, or network fundamentals.
